What social skills do you get by playing board game?

How do Board Games Enhance Social Skills? Board games help children learn important social skills such as waiting, turn taking, sharing, how to cope with losing, making conversation, problem solving, compromising, collaborating and being flexible.

How do board games improve social skills?

Board games encourage children to develop vital social skills including persuasive language, supportive language, and politeness during general gaming discussions. These are skills that otherwise may not be developed in everyday activities and can be applied when children attend school, clubs or social situations.

How do board games help child development?

Just by virtue of playing the game, children learn the value of patience, verbal communication and interaction with others, thus developing their social skills even further. By learning how to wait for their turns, board games can also help a child to develop self-regulation skills, focus and lengthen attention span.

Does gaming encourage positive communication?

The "shared cultural experience" of gaming also supports positive communication with friends and family, according to researchers. The survey found that 3 in 4 (76.3%) young people who play talk to their friends about video games, compared to only 3 in 10 (29.4%) who discuss books.

What are the benefits of children playing games?

Research shows play can improve children's abilities to plan, organize, get along with others, and regulate emotions. In addition, play helps with language, math and social skills, and even helps children cope with stress.
